The Yaris keyless entry system allows drivers to unlock and start their vehicles without manually using the key fob. This system comprises two main components: the key fob and the vehicle receiver. The key fob has a battery and sends a low-frequency radio signal to the vehicle receiver when a button is pushed. The receiver is located near the steering column, and its function is to detect the signal from the key fob and unlock the doors or start the engine, depending on the button pressed.
This advanced technology offers convenience and enhances overall vehicle security. With keyless entry, drivers can unlock their cars without getting the fob out of their pockets or bags. The system automatically detects the fob's presence when the driver approaches the vehicle, allowing for seamless access. Additionally, the keyless entry system includes anti-grab and rolling code features, making it extremely difficult for unauthorized users to access the vehicle. There are several types of Yaris keyless entry systems:
Passive Keyless Entry
The Passive Keyless Entry system is a highly convenient and advanced technology that allows drivers to unlock and access their vehicles without manually using the key fob. With this system, the key fob can remain in the pocket or bag, allowing for seamless entry. The vehicle is equipped with multiple antennas that continuously monitor the signals from the key fob. When the driver approaches the car, the system detects their presence, and the driver can unlock the doors by touching a designated area on the door handle. This enables the driver to access the vehicle without the need to locate and press the button on the key fob. Once inside, the driver can start the engine with a push button, further enhancing the convenience of the PKES system.
Smart Key System
The Smart Key System is an advanced keyless entry technology that allows drivers to unlock and start their vehicles conveniently and securely. Unlike traditional key fobs, the smart key fob communicates wirelessly with the car, enabling passive entry and ignition control. With the Smart Key System, drivers can unlock their vehicles by simply touching a designated area on the door handle, even with the key fob in their pocket or purse. Moreover, starting the engine is just as effortless, as drivers can initiate the engine with a simple push of a button, all while the smart key remains inside their bag or pocket.
Proximity Key System
The Proximity Key System is a highly advanced and convenient technology that allows drivers to unlock and start their vehicles without manually using traditional key methods. With the Proximity Key System, as long as the key fob is inside the car, the driver can perform various functions, such as starting the engine with a push button, unlocking the doors, and even opening the trunk. This eliminates the need to take the key fob out of the pocket or purse, making accessing and operating the vehicle incredibly seamless and efficient. The Proximity Key System significantly enhances convenience, especially in situations where quick access to the vehicle is essential.
The specifications of Yaris keyless entry systems vary depending on the make and model of the car, as well as the specific key fob design. Here are some common features:
Key Fob Design
The key fob for Yaris keyless entry is compact and usually has 3 to 5 buttons. These buttons may include the lock, unlock, trunk release, and panic alarm. Some key fobs may also have a vehicle locator button that flashes the lights to help find the car in a parking lot. The key fob has a battery that needs to be replaced periodically, typically every 1 to 3 years, depending on usage and battery type. The replacement process is usually simple, involving opening the fob and replacing the battery.
Proximity Sensors
The keyless entry system uses proximity sensors in the key fob and the car to detect when the key fob is close to the vehicle. This allows for keyless unlocking and starting. The key fob emits a low-frequency signal, and the car's keyless entry system responds by sending a signal back. This two-way communication ensures that only the authenticated key fob can access the vehicle.
Start Button
Another feature of the keyless entry system is the start button, usually located on the dashboard. With the key fob inside the car and the brake pedal pressed, the driver can push the start button to turn the engine on or off. This is convenient and adds a layer of security, as the car cannot be started without the authenticated key fob inside.
Security Features
The Yaris keyless entry system has several security features to prevent unauthorized access and engine start. These features include rolling code technology, encryption, and immobilizer integration. Rolling code technology changes the code sent by the key fob to the car with each use. This ensures that even if someone intercepts the code once, it cannot be used again. Encryption adds another layer of security by making it difficult for attackers to decipher the communication between the key fob and the car. The immobilizer is a security system that prevents the engine from starting unless the authenticated key fob sends a signal to the car.

Understand the car model and year
Different Yaris car models have different Yaris keyless entry systems. Also, keyless entry systems that are compatible with a particular Yaris model may not be compatible with another. Therefore, before choosing the keyless entry system, understand the car model and the year it was manufactured.
Consider the remote range
When choosing Yaris keyless entries, consider the remote range. The remote range determines how far the user can stand away from the car and still be able to lock, unlock, or access the trunk. If the Yaris owner prefers keyless entry with a longer remote range, choose those with a longer remote range.
Understand the frequency
Different Yaris keyless entry systems operate at different frequencies. The most common frequency is 315 MHz. However, some keyless entry systems operate at 433 MHz. Before choosing a Yaris keyless entry system, understand the frequency that is compatible with a particular car model.
Security features
Security features are important considerations when choosing Yaris keyless entries. Look for keyless entries with encryption codes that change with each use. Also, consider keyless entries with rolling code technology. Such keyless entries cannot be easily intercepted or replicated by thieves.

Q1: Can any Yaris use a universal key fob?
A1: No, not all Yaris can use a universal key fob. Key fobs are designed for specific makes, models, and years of vehicles. A universal key fob may work for some cars, but it has to be programmed to match the car's specifications.
Q2: What should be done if the Yaris key fob stops working?
A2: Firstly, the battery of the key fob should be checked and replaced if necessary. If it still doesn't work, there might be a need to reprogram it, which can be done by following the Yaris keyless entry system instructions, or by a professional locksmith or dealer.
Q3: Does the Toyota Yaris have a smart key?
A3: The Toyota Yaris may have a smart key available on some models. The smart key is a keyless entry and ignition system that allows drivers to unlock doors and start the engine while carrying the key in their pocket or purse.
Q4: Is it possible to install a keyless entry system in a Yaris that doesn't have one?
A4: Yes, it is possible to install a keyless entry system in a Yaris that doesn't have one. Various aftermarket keyless entry systems are available and can be installed by a professional.
Q5: What is the range of the Yaris keyless entry system?
A5: The typical range for keyless entry systems, including the Yaris keyless entry system, is about 30 feet (10 meters). However, the range may vary depending on environmental factors and interference.
